Computer Slowed/Trojan Downloader Found
Hello, I had recently been feeling my computer has been going slow at some points on the internet, and my first instinct was of course to check for a virus/spyware. AVG and Spybot (AVG did about 2 weeks back give me something about Java relating to Java Quick Start, which I disabled in Firefox, and it no longer detected it afterwards) gave me the okay that nothing was wrong, but I ran the Kaspersky Internet Scan which found two infections.
File name / Threat name / Threats count C:\Documents and Settings\(My Username)\Application Data\Sun\Java\Deployment\cache\6.0\19\1f895f53-64b32e58 Infected: Trojan-Downloader.Java.OpenConnection.aj 2 C:\Documents and Settings\(My Username)\Application Data\Sun\Java\Deployment\cache\6.0\19\1f895f53-64b32e58 Infected: Exploit.Java.ByteVerify 2 Now, I did a quick Google search and was unable to find anyone with exactly this infection, but some who did had piles of problems on top of it, while I have received nothing but the occasional slowdown online, no pop-ups or anything suspicious. I also checked the other variation of the file on the viruslist site Kaspersky showed me to, and I could not find the two .exe files it allegedly creates. Also wondering, I have used USB flash drives and a portable harddrive during the time of the slowdown. Is there any worry of an infection on them? Here's my DDS, and again thanks for the help! Re: Computer Slowed/Trojan Downloader Found
An update on this.
I was Googling around checking for similar problems such as this, and one forum suggested clearing the Temp files for Java. I did this, and then had Kaspersky re-scan the folders where the original infection was found, and it gave me the clear. However, the whole Trojan-Downloader doesn't seem very good, and am wondering if I still might have some infection, or if any external devices I may have plugged in may have been contaminated.
